10 Hobbies Men Voted Are Green Flags When Dating Women

Are there certain hobbies you find irresistible in a partner? I love that my husband loves comic books. Watching him delight in the artwork and get excited about the details in the stories is adorable. An online platform recently surveyed men, asking which hobbies they found to be massive green flags when dating women. These topped the list.

1. Botany

woman watering plants botany hobby
Image Credit: Dragana Gordic/Shutterstock.

From spider plants and fiddle leaf figs to succulents and floral arrangements, men adore plant ladies. Women who have a green thumb and keep their plants alive are something they deeply admire.

2. Reading

woman reading in home with plants
Image Credit: Alliance Images/Shutterstock.

Reading is a green-flag hobby that indicates that you appreciate learning and growing. Reading also demonstrates intelligence and is something men admit they find extremely attractive.

3. Singing

woman singing headphones hobby
Image Credit: Africa Studio/Shutterstock.

Who doesn’t appreciate a beautiful singing voice? The idea of listening to a woman enjoying herself through song is something many men confess they desire in a woman. Singing is a great flag hobby.

4. Playing Games

Vietnamese couple playing board game chess
Image Credit: Dragon Images/Shutterstock.

Of course, not mental games, but board, card, and video game playing is a green flag for many of the men who voted in the survey. A huge benefit to this hobby is that it is something you can share together.

5. Working Out

woman working out exercise high five
Image Credit: NDAB Creativity/Shutterstock.

Working out, weightlifting, and classes like yoga and dancing are green-flag hobbies. Typically, these indicate a woman’s willingness to do hard things, dedication, and discipline to keep doing them to achieve results.

6. Gardening

Dragon Images
Image Credit: Gilles Lougassi/Shutterstock.

Gardening reflects a nurturing personality and an appreciation for life’s simple pleasures. My stepmom loves botany and gardening, and I remember my father being wholly enamored by her love of those hobbies. So it tickles me to see so many men delighted by that passion.

7. Sewing

woman sewing hobby
Image Credit: Gilles Lougassi/Shutterstock.

Sewing is a creative hobby that results in beautiful patterns and stitching. It can also be beneficial for making clothing, blankets, and other linens. Homemade items will last years longer than anything you find in the store.

8. Knitting and Crocheting

woman knitting hands crochet
Image Credit: littlenySTOCK/Shutterstock.

Knitting and crocheting are two different creative hobbies these men voted as significant green flags. I’m nostalgic for the days when every couch had a crocheted throw on the back of it.

9. Fixing Things

handywoman carpenter building tools
Image Credit: Narint Asawaphisith/Shutterstock.

Men love women who can take things apart, fix them, and put them back together. Women who use the free knowledge on YouTube are attractive. Repurposing furniture and anything crafty is something men value as a green flag hobby, too.

10. Fishing

woman fishing in river hobby
Image Credit: PRESSLAB/Shutterstock.

Fishing is a hobby men wish more women enjoyed and is a welcomed green flag. Sitting on a riverbank or in a boat, having someone sit in the quiet of nature while catching fish, is beautiful.
